HttpsEdit

HTTPS, or Hypertext Transfer Protocol Secure, is the secure version of the standard web protocol that underpins the modern internet. By wrapping each connection in cryptographic protection, HTTPS reduces the risk of eavesdropping, tampering, and impersonation while data travels between a user’s device and a website or service. In practical terms, this means passwords, payment details, personal messages, and other sensitive information are shielded from onlookers and malicious actors as it moves across the global network. The protocol relies on a combination of encryption, authentication, and integrity checks, and it is built on a foundation of widely adopted standards and infrastructure that make secure web communication possible at scale. For a foundational understanding, see Hypertext Transfer Protocol and the secure extension discussed here as Hypertext Transfer Protocol Secure.

HTTPS is the result of layering secure cryptographic protocols on top of the familiar HTTP request/response model. At its core, HTTPS uses TLS to provide confidentiality and integrity and to authenticate the server (and, in some configurations, the client). This arrangement aligns with a market-based, voluntary approach to security: when businesses protect customer data by default, trust increases, and consumers are more willing to transact online. The same security model also reduces the potential for governmental or other third-party overreach to gather private communications, aligning with general market principles of voluntary exchange founded on confidence in the reliability of information flows. See Transport Layer Security and Public Key Infrastructure for the technical backbone, and Certificate Authority systems that help certify server identities.

History

The secure extension of HTTP emerged from decades of effort to make the Web safer without stifling innovation. Early efforts built on Secure Sockets Layer, the predecessor protocol from which TLS evolved. The industry gradually moved to adopt TLS, and the IETF standardization process produced successive versions, with TLS 1.3 representing a streamlined, faster, and more privacy-preserving set of capabilities that remains widely supported. The widespread deployment of HTTPS accelerated as the ecosystem of certificates, certificate authorities, and automated provisioning matured. Notable landmarks include the rise of free and automated certificate provisioning through Let's Encrypt and the introduction of protections like HTTP Strict Transport Security to reduce the risk of protocol downgrade or misconfiguration.

How HTTPS works

  • Handshake and encryption: When a user connects to a site, the client and server perform a TLS handshake that negotiates an encryption cipher and establishes a shared session key. This process protects data from eavesdropping and tampering during transit. See TLS for the formal specification and the details of cipher suites and key exchange mechanisms.
  • Authentication: The server presents a digital certificate, issued by a Certificate Authority and validated against a chain of trust rooted in trusted CAs embedded in browsers and operating systems. This helps the client verify that it is communicating with the intended server and not an impostor. The mechanism is part of the broader Public Key Infrastructure framework.
  • Integrity and confidentiality: Once the handshake completes, the session uses symmetric encryption with the derived keys, ensuring confidentiality, while cryptographic integrity checks prevent alterations to data in transit.
  • Revocation and trust management: If a certificate is compromised or misissued, revocation mechanisms and transparency measures seek to minimize the duration of risk. See Certificate Transparency and related topics for ongoing governance of trust.

Terminology and components commonly encountered in HTTPS deployments include HTTP/3, which builds on QUIC for improved performance, and the move from legacy SSL toward modern TLS configurations that emphasize stronger defaults and better resistance to known attacks. See also X.509 certificates and the broader Public Key Infrastructure model.

Adoption and impact

  • Security and privacy in commerce: HTTPS is the default standard for most e-commerce, login flows, and sensitive communications. By encrypting data in transit, it protects customers and businesses from the most common forms of data compromise and supports a healthier digital marketplace.
  • Search and performance incentives: Major platforms and browsers have aligned incentives to promote secure connections, with several search and performance considerations encouraging or rewarding sites that implement HTTPS and related protections such as HTTP Strict Transport Security and modern TLS configurations.
  • Accessibility and cost: The availability of free or low-cost certificates and automated provisioning has lowered barriers to deployment, enabling small sites and startups to participate in secure web practices. See Let's Encrypt for context on certificate provisioning in a broad ecosystem.

From a market-oriented perspective, the shift toward universal HTTPS reduces information asymmetry and transaction risk. When users can trust that their data is protected in transit, consumer confidence grows, enabling more efficient markets and online services. The policy debate around HTTPS often centers on two questions: how to balance privacy with legitimate law enforcement needs, and how to prevent abuse or misissuance within the PKI system. Proposals for “backdoors” or universal access to encrypted communications are widely contested, because they can introduce systemic weaknesses that undermine overall security and trust in the same systems that enable lawful commerce and data protection.

Security, privacy, and policy debates

  • Encryption versus lawful access: A central controversy is whether governments should require “backdoors” or other forms of deliberate access to encrypted data. Proponents argue for targeted, proportional mechanisms with robust oversight, while opponents contend that even narrowly scoped access introduces vulnerabilities that criminals can exploit and that weaken privacy and security for everyone.
  • The case against backdoors: The core worry is that any deliberate weakness becomes a target for exploitation by criminals, foreign adversaries, or careless actors. From a market and security standpoint, a robust, accountable encryption regime tends to preserve user trust and reduce risk across sectors, including financial services, healthcare, and consumer apps. Critics of compelled access argue that secure, private communications enable legitimate activities—business negotiations, whistleblowing, personal privacy—without creating opportunities for abuse that circumvention measures attempt to solve.
  • Widespread deployment and security hygiene: The HTTPS ecosystem relies on diligent certificate management, timely software updates, and correct configurations. Misissuance, weak cipher choices, and certificate mismanagement can undermine security even when the underlying protocol is sound. In practice, the market has rewarded better default configurations, automated provisioning, and transparency initiatives that help administrators maintain secure deployments. See Certificate Authority governance and Certificate Transparency for governance measures.

From a practical, right-leaning policy lens, a strong encryption regime is aligned with protecting private property, encouraging investment in digital services, and facilitating voluntary exchanges in a highly connected economy. Critics who argue for broad access or mandatory surveillance often underestimate the risk that such measures create for the broader security of networks and the integrity of online commerce, potentially increasing costs and friction for legitimate users and businesses. Supporters of robust HTTPS practices emphasize that secure, trustworthy networks are a prerequisite for innovation, competitiveness, and national resilience in a digital age.

Standards and governance

  • TLS evolution and standards: TLS has evolved through multiple generations, with TLS 1.3 offering improved security and performance characteristics. The standardization work is led by the IETF and implemented by software and hardware vendors across the ecosystem.
  • PKI and certificate authorities: The validation of server identities relies on a Public Key Infrastructure comprising issued certificates from Certificate Authority and browser-supplied root stores. Governance, transparency, and revocation mechanisms are critical for maintaining trust.
  • Governance bodies and best practices: Industry groups and governance forums, such as the CA/Browser Forum and related standards bodies, help align interoperability, certificate policies, and revocation practices to ensure broad compatibility and security.

Performance and usability

  • Efficiency gains: Advances in TLS, particularly TLS 1.3, reduce the number of round-trips required during a handshake and streamline cryptographic operations, contributing to faster page loads and smoother experiences on both mobile and desktop platforms.
  • Protocols and optimization: The use of newer protocols such as HTTP/3 and encryption-aware transport mechanisms minimizes latency and improves throughput, especially on networks with higher latency or packet loss.
  • Accessibility and compatibility: While HTTPS is now ubiquitous, careful deployment remains important to avoid mixed content issues and to ensure accessibility for users across different devices and network environments. Practices like proper certificate management and adherence to modern security headers are central to a good user experience.

See also